Summary: What does it mean to 'trust' political institutions? And how can local government play its part in raising the level of political discourse? This week, we focus on transparency and accountability in the democratic process with highlights from our recent event on trust and briefings on the DCMS Civil Society Strategy, proposed new electoral laws on social media and the Carillion collapse. Plus our regular roundup of news from the past two weeks including Sadiq Khan's new knife crime unit, tackling county lines gangs and some lighter stories involving ravens and wheelie bins in our 'And Finally' section.
